Our family is heartbroken to share that our beloved Rose Marie Krantz passed away peacefully on Sunday, June 14, 2026, at the age of 91. She was surrounded by her loved ones. She was a lifelong prominent, deeply loved, and respected pillar of Morro Bay and Los Osos, and she was, quite simply, amazing!
Rose Marie’s greatest joy was her family. She was a deeply devoted matriarch, embracing her role with unconditional love all the way from mother to grandmother, great-grandmother, and great-great-grandmother. She spent her entire life looking out for others. For years, she cared for elderly residents at the historic Seashell Retirement Home with love, kindness, and grace.
Alongside her dedicated group of friends in the Central Coast Circle of Friends, she poured her heart into uplifting the community. Together, they made warm blankets for CASA, collected essential food and clothing for the Salvation Army and local food banks, and worked the tables at the Walk for Hunger. Rose Marie was also deeply committed to ensuring her neighbors were cared for, regularly helping feed up to 120 people in need — first at Lila Keiser Park and later at the Vet’s Hall.
As a longtime, cherished face at Morro Shores, Rose Marie was known for her unforgettable coast-side presence and her beautifully fierce independence. She completely adored the raw beauty of our local coast and always reminded us how lucky she was to live there. She will be missed beyond words by our family, her dear friends, and the community she loved so dearly.
